Japan's Police Consultation Number
The Police Consultation hotline number is "#9110" in Japan. This number is for non-emergencies. It connects you to a General Advisory Center where you can receive advice on various troubles. They give the following examples of the sort of things you can consult about; domestic violence, stalking, shady businesses. The consultation number differs from 110, which is strictly for immediate, urgent situations like a crime in progress or a traffic accident.
To create awareness of the service and the number, today and September 11th annually, is Police Consultation Number Day! The date was chose because the date, in Japanese style, is the first three numbers of the phone number. In Japan dates are written year/ month / day. So, excluding the year, today is 9/11. The anniversary was established by the National Police Agency in 1999.
Interestingly, the "#9110" number is also the place where you can lodge opinions and / or complaints about the police in general or a policeman / woman / officer. Have you ever dialled the #9110 number in Japan? I personally have no experience of using it.
